We use Zuken Cadstar - it appears to output files with *.spl extension and *.rep. I was told that these are the Gerber outputs for designs in Cadstar (and they look Gerber files when I open them with a text editor). Could you confirm that these the files to send for pcb production ?

With respect to the *.spl files this is Gerber format (RS274 D) and the *.rep file is a separate aperture list for each file. You may find it a little easier if your Zuken Cadstar can extract Extended Gerber files (RS274 X). The apertures are embedded in the file, and you simply read one file per layer into GC-PREVUE.
